Abstract

The fiction of J. G. Ballard is unusually concerned with spaces, both internal and external. Influenced by Surrealism and Freudian psychoanalysis, Ballard’s texts explore the thin divide between mind and body. This analysis of the story “The terminal beach” illustrates well some of the concepts present throughout his fiction.
